Master’s programmes

A master’s programme is a research-based full-time degree programme that provides students with qualifications for entering a profession or for admission to a PhD programme.

Thus, the overall objective of the master’s programme is for students to further develop their knowledge and insight into the discipline and, on this basis, acquire nuanced knowledge of the theories, methods and core fields of research of the discipline. Furthermore, students will develop their individual qualification profiles in an interplay between their discipline and other disciplines and/or professions.

Students will learn to be critical of their own subject area and to work independently on solving theoretical and practical issues through the application of principles, working methods and other disciplinary perspectives.
